基于主成分分析的左室Tei指数参考值的地理分布

         

摘要

Objective: To provide a scientific standard of left ventricular Tei index for healthy people from various region of China, and to lay a reliable foundation for the evaluation of left ventricular diastolic and systolic function. Methods: The correlation and principal component analysis were used to explore the left ventricular Tei index, which based on the data of 3 562 samples from 50 regions of China by means of literature retrieval. hTe nine geographical factors were longitude(X1), latitude(X2), altitude(X3), annual sunshine hours (X4), the annual average temperature (X5), annual average relative humidity (X6), annual precipitation (X7), annual temperature range (X8) and annual average wind speed (X9). ArcGIS sotfware was applied to calculate the spatial distribution regularities of letf ventricular Tei index. Results: hTere is a signiifcant correlation between the healthy people’s letf ventricular Tei index and geographical factors, and the correlationcoeffcients were 0.107 (r1), 0.301 (r2), 0.029 (r3), 0.277 (r4),−0.256(r5),−0.289(r6),−0.320(r7), 0.310 (r8) and 0.117 (r9), respectively. A linear equation between the Tei index and the geographical factor was obtained by regression analysis based on the three extracting principal components. hTe geographical distribution tendency chart for healthy people’s letf Tei index was iftted out by the ArcGIS spatial interpolation analysis. Conclusion: hTe geographical distribution for letf ventricular Tei index in China follows certain pattern. hTe reference value in North is higher than that in South, while the value in East is higher than that in West.%目的:为中国不同地区的健康人左心室Tei指数参考值提供一个科学依据,为左室舒张和收缩的整体功能的评价提供一个较为可靠的判断依据。方法:通过文献检索收集来自50个市(县)的3562例健康人左室Tei指数,将其与9项地理指标,即经度(X1)、纬度(X2)、海拔(X3)、年日照时数(X4)、年平均气温(X5)、年平均相对湿度(X6)、年降水量(X7)、气温年较差(X8)、年平均风速(X9),进行简单相关分析和主成分分析;应用ArcGIS10.0软件探索左室Tei指数的空间分布规律。结果:健康人左室Tei指数与9项地理指标之间存在显著相关性,相关系数分别为r1=0.107, r2=0.301,r3=0.029,r4=0.277,r5=−0.256,r6=−0.289,r7=−0.320,r8=0.310,r9=0.117。根据提取的3个主成分与Tei指数进行回归分析,获得了Tei指数与地理指标间的线性模型。应用ArcGIS10.0软件进行插值分析,拟合出健康人左室Tei指数的空间分布趋势图。结论:中国人左室Tei指数参考值存在一定的地理分布规律——西高东低,北高南低。
